By Richard Saferstein Spectrophotometry A substance can interact with visible light to produce color Can also interact with invisible radiation Spectrophotometry –measures the quantity of radiation that a material absorbs as a function of wavelength/frequency. –Quantity of light absorbed at any frequency is directly proportional to the concentration of the absorbing molecules. This is known as Beer’s Law.

By Richard Saferstein UVand IR Spectrophotometry Currently, most forensic laboratories use UV and IR spectrophotometers to characterize chemical compounds. The simplicity of the UV spectrum is a great a tool for determining a material’s probable identity –it may not be definitive. heroin caffeine

By Richard Saferstein UVand IR Spectrophotometry The IR spectrum provides a far more complex pattern. Different molecules always have distinctively different infrared spectra –Like a fingerprint

5-5 ©2011, 2008 Pearson Education, Inc. Upper Saddle River, NJ FORENSIC SCIENCE: An Introduction, 2 nd ed. By Richard Saferstein Mass Spectrometry In the mass spectrometer, a beam of high-energy electrons collide with a material, producing positively charged ions.

5-6 ©2011, 2008 Pearson Education, Inc. Upper Saddle River, NJ FORENSIC SCIENCE: An Introduction, 2 nd ed. By Richard Saferstein Mass Spectrometry positive ions decompose into numerous fragments –separated according to their masses. NO two substances produce the same fragmentation pattern.

5-7 ©2011, 2008 Pearson Education, Inc. Upper Saddle River, NJ FORENSIC SCIENCE: An Introduction, 2 nd ed. By Richard Saferstein GC and Mass Spec GC: Separation of different molecules MS: Identification of each molecule according to it’s fragments.
